Explore Parc Natural de s'Albufera des Grau, Mahón - A Tranquil Wildlife Haven
Parc Natural de s'Albufera des Grau, located in Mahón, Islas Baleares, Spain, is a stunning natural park that offers a unique blend of marshland conservation and recreational activities. This beautiful park is renowned for its diverse wildlife, making it a popular destination for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ts alike. Visitors can enjoy birdwatching, kayaking, and snorkeling, all while soaking in the serene landscapes that define this tranquil oasis.
Amenities & Activities
At Parc Natural de s'Albufera des Grau, visitors can indulge in a variety of activities that enhance their experience in this natural wonder. Key features include:
- Birdwatching: The park is home to numerous bird species, making it a prime spot for birdwatching enthusiasts.
- Kayaking: Explore the tranquil waters of the marshlands by kayak, offering a unique perspective of the park's beauty.
- Snorkeling: Discover the underwater life in the clear waters, perfect for both beginners and experienced snorkelers.
- Walking Trails: Enjoy scenic walks around the park, with routes suitable for all ages and fitness levels.
- Picnicking: Designated areas are available for picnicking, making it a great spot for families.
Location & Nearby Attractions
Situated along the Carretera de Maó a Es Grau, Parc Natural de s'Albufera des Grau is easily accessible and is surrounded by other attractions that enhance your visit. Nearby, you can explore the charming village of Es Grau, known for its beautiful beach and local dining options. The park is also a short drive from Mahón, where visitors can discover historical sites and vibrant markets.
